Output 62d92057ae07416378c708935eac8cc81e76b4777b249911f97a6fbab56aaf50:46

value
18804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b65b443def78200eeb0c31c4b4ecda2738808d4a OP_EQUALVERIFY OP_CHECKSIG
address
1HdDKE5uFYh3bqw3awYGiuLC4Mymo2tAmS
transaction
62d92057ae07416378c708935eac8cc81e76b4777b249911f97a6fbab56aaf50
spent
true